Within our Client AI & Analytics team, CAIA, we have built our own multi-agent AI platform from scratch. The platform is used by commercial colleagues such as private bankers, relationship advisors and financial advisors. It supports them across a wide range of use cases, including client summaries, end-of-year reviews, meeting notes, investment proposal reviews and other daily advisory workflows. 

The platform combines the use of frontier AI models, agentic workflows and a growing set of capabilities across text, voice, memory and personalisation. We are moving beyond one-size-fits-all AI towards a platform that can better understand how different colleagues work, communicate and serve their clients. 

This internship focuses on GEPA-based self-optimisation. GEPA, or Genetic-Pareto, is a reflective optimisation framework that uses evaluation signals, traces and natural-language reflection to evolve prompts and other textual components of AI systems. It can be applied to prompts, instructions, agent configurations and broader compound AI systems.
